Citations
3 citations on file for this inspection.
1926.100 A
- Issued
- Dec 3, 2021
- Penalty
- Initial $3,121 · Current $2,341 Reduced
General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1926.100(a): Employees were not protected by protective helmets while working in areas where there was a possible danger of head injury from impact, or from falling or flying objects, or from electrical shock and burns: a) Exterior of Building - Front - Vestibule: Employee without the use of protective helmet was exposed to head injury while engaged in roofing activity under others employees working on roof, on or about 7/20/21.

1926.501 B13
- Issued
- Dec 3, 2021
- Penalty
- Initial $5,461 · Current $4,096 Reduced
General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1926.501(b)(13): Each employee(s) engaged in residential construction activities 6 feet (1.8 m) or more above lower levels were not protected by guardrail systems, safety net system, or personal fall arrest system, nor were employee(s) provided with an alternative fall protection measure under another provision of paragraph 1926.501 (b). a) Exterior of Building - Front and side Roof: Employees without proper means of fall protection were exposed to fall hazards varying from approximately 10 feet to 25 feet while engaged in roofing activities, on or about 7/20/21.

1926.1053 B01
- Issued
- Dec 3, 2021
- Penalty
- Initial $3,121 · Current $2,341 Reduced
General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1926.1053(b)(1): Portable ladders were used for access to an upper landing surface and the ladder side rails did not extend at least 3 feet (.9 m) above the upper landing surface to which the ladder was used to gain access: a) Exterior of Building - Front Vestibule: Employee was exposed to approximately 10 feet fall hazard while utilizing an extension ladder that only extend approximately 18 inches over the working surface, on or about 7/20/21.
